Fungsi InternetLockRequestFile (wininet.h)
Tempatkan kunci pada file yang sedang digunakan.
Sintaks
BOOL InternetLockRequestFile(
[in] HINTERNET hInternet,
[out] HANDLE *lphLockRequestInfo
);
Parameter
[in] hInternet
Menangani yang dikembalikan oleh fungsi FtpOpenFile, GopherOpenFile, HttpOpenRequest, atau InternetOpenUrl .
[out] lphLockRequestInfo
Penunjuk ke handel yang menerima handel permintaan kunci.
Menampilkan nilai
Mengembalikan TRUE jika berhasil, atau FALSE sebaliknya. Untuk mendapatkan pesan kesalahan tertentu, panggil GetLastError.
Keterangan
Jika handel HINTERNET yang diteruskan ke hInternet dibuat menggunakan INTERNET_FLAG_NO_CACHE_WRITE atau INTERNET_FLAG_DONT_CACHE, fungsi membuat file sementara dengan ekstensi .tmp, kecuali jika itu adalah sumber daya HTTPS. Jika handel dibuat menggunakan INTERNET_FLAG_NO_CACHE_WRITE atau INTERNET_FLAG_DONT_CACHE dan mengakses sumber daya HTTPS, InternetLockRequestFile gagal.
Seperti semua aspek lain dari Api WinINet, fungsi ini tidak dapat dipanggil dengan aman dari dalam DllMain atau konstruktor dan destruktor objek global.
Persyaratan
Klien minimum yang didukung | Windows 2000 Professional [hanya aplikasi desktop] |
Server minimum yang didukung | Windows 2000 Server [hanya aplikasi desktop] |
Target Platform | Windows |
Header | wininet.h |
Pustaka | Wininet.lib |
DLL | Wininet.dll |
Lihat juga
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k